EEP: Ltd. Ebb

CK - Washington.   The German hoopla over the English corporate form of Limited and its use in Germany appears to ebb. Interest in the form is waning, according to Flensburg tax and insolvency specialists Ehler Ermer & Partner. The October 2005 issue of the EPP Journal reports a recognition in German corporate minds that meeting mandatory English and German balance sheet requirements and annual notifications to two corporate registers increases costs and efforts substantially while the benefit of minimal capitalization is marginal. EEP does not advocate an end to the use of the Ltd. in Germany but recommends proper decision-making and planning before implementing such a concept. German business may also want to look at the benefits of American corporate forms which are simple to establish and maintain and have lower capitalization requirements than German corporations.
